>> On 25 March 2015 at 07:59, Carlos Córdoba <ccordoba12 at gmail.com> wrote:
>>
>>> Could you explain a bit more how this is going to work? I say it because
>>> I see that you're moving the repos inside the IPython one instead of moving
>>> them directly out of it.
>>
>>
>> That's only a temporary step, so that we can move files between
>> components while preserving the git history. Once we've got the pieces
>> satisfactorily separated inside the IPython repository, we will split it up
>> into one repository for each component.
